Everything maidened today was new.The 14mz on 2.4. and the 2.1m Yak 55 along with a new DA 50....All i can say is WOW...75 paces with the radio gear and not a quiver DA 50 started on very first flip

The little Yak 55 is an absolute awesome plane ...After owning 3 Yak 54s and having the Comp-Arf 2.6m Yak and now the 2.1m, i must say i believe the Yak 55 is a better plane

The 2.4 system is absolutely awesome...Gonna have to learn how to fly again because the responce seems to instantaneous compared to 72...Dang i'm going to have to buy more receivers
